Most of the time T/Os are performed wit F1, but if your calcs were for F2 or even F3 there was NO warning if you put the flap lever to F1 for T/O.....
Another thing is Tflex. Neither on A320 nor on A340 flex temp was asked for in a checklist on my operator. Well, on A300 it was....
Airbus is generally quick to find fixes and both these issues have fixed. Flex temperature is very much a part of the C/L for a long time now. As far as config warning is concerned in conventional A320 it was just an assurance that you are not outside takeoff configuration. Now Airline can opt for new app that will compare the actual configuration with the MCDU entry. Acceleration check in my opinion is not possible when thrust settings vary by as much as 40% nor is it required when everything else is in place. Trend arrow is a good indicator it can even indicate a wind shear.
